For millennia there’s been a fascination and a fear of people possibly wielding magical powers and a stigma surrounding practitioners of ancient rituals and practices. Yet, in the last 70 years, witchcraft, as well as Wicca, have gone from taboo beliefs pursued by a handful of eccentrics and misfits to major global, spiritual movements. In this book, you’ll be introduced to the history, persecutions, conjurings, and magic of some of history’s most consequential witches, sorcerers, wizards, and mavericks.
